This illuminating book argues that science has had an unequivocally positive effect on society, but that the world is facing a crisis because man has failed to extend its methods and spirit to other areas of life. Delving into the history of science, the author shows how its revolutionary discoveries have changed every aspect of human existence, from our understanding of the universe to the food we eat. Yet despite our technological advancements, the author laments that we still struggle with many of the same problems that plagued our ancestors. The author believes that the key to overcoming these challenges lies in applying the scientific method, with its emphasis on observation, experimentation, and reason, to all aspects of human endeavor. Only by embracing a truly scientific mindset can we hope to create a better, more just, and more sustainable world for ourselves and future generations.
